Ticket #4182 — Expired credentials for quota service

The Thornvale quota service key expired last night, so per-tenant rate limits are falling back to global defaults. Tenants on premium tiers are getting throttled. Fix: update the config in the metering deployment and restart. Verify with a test call against the staging tenant. Use the replacement key below.

service key, yadug-bajog: zpat3_pou

// Broker upgrade notes for plugin authors:
// Quillbus 4.x replaces the legacy 3.x wire protocol. Plugins must
// construct the client with explicit protocol negotiation enabled,
// or connections to the Larkfield cluster will be silently downgraded
// and dropped after 30s. Topic names are unchanged. For local testing
// against the sandbox broker, authenticate with the key below.

API key for bafof-bagaf: qvz2-qi

Adds chunked bulk edits to the Ledgerbird admin table. Previously, editing 500+ rows fired one giant transaction and occasionally deadlocked against the sync worker. Now edits are batched, each batch retried independently with backoff. New folks: don't change batch sizing without checking the p99 lock-wait dashboard first — the Fernhaven incident happened exactly that way. Tests cover partial-failure rollback and idempotent retries. Tuning constants live in `bulk_config.py` and are reproduced below for review.

constants for tageg-kagag:
QUOTAS = {
    "kelax": 495,
    "istath": 366,
    "tammir": 108,
    "novdor": 730,
    "casax": 816,
    "quenael": 874,
    "pelius": 403,
}